You are on page 1of 4

Se implementara control de una variable de nivel con el pic 16f877A, con el programa de

mikroc programare todo mi seting de mi pic.

Quiero incluir las bibliotecas de manera ya que con esto me genera menos gasto de
memoria.

Configuracin de bibliotecas lcd.

Ya podemos iniciar con el cdigo que me dar libre accesos al control de nivel on off ya
que sabemos que 1 es abierto y cero cerrado, como en este paso la idea no es implementar
el cdigo si no mostrar lo que si es viable y funciona dejo registro con le pantallazo del
cdigo compilado:
Este cdigo se implement y se simulo en proteus el cual la idea principal es que cada
botn se un estado lgico 1 on y 0 off por ende cuando el agua llegue al nivel este se
activar y pic implementara el cdigo:

Nivel del agua en estado 2: LCD1


LM016L

RV1

50%

VDD
VSS

VEE

RW
RS

D0
D1
D2
D3
D4
D5
D6
D7
E
1
2
3

4
5
6

7
8
9
10
11
12
13
14
1k
Reinicio

U1
13 33
OSC1/CLKIN RB0/INT
14 34
OSC2/CLKOUT RB1
35
RB2
2 36
RA0/AN0 RB3/PGM
3
4
RA1/AN1
RA2/AN2/VREF-/CVREF
RB4
RB5
37
38 Simulacion de niveles
5 39
RA3/AN3/VREF+ RB6/PGC
6 40
7
RA4/T0CKI/C1OUT RB7/PGD D1
RA5/AN4/SS/C2OUT R2
R1 RC0/T1OSO/T1CKI
15 R3 NIVEL 10 NIVEL 8 NIVEL 6 NIVEL 4 NIVEL2
10k 8 16 R4
330
RE0/AN5/RD RC1/T1OSI/CCP2
9 17 R5 LED-RED
10
RE1/AN6/WR RC2/CCP1
18
330 D2
RE2/AN7/CS RC3/SCK/SCL
23
R6
330
RC4/SDI/SDA 330
1 24 330
MCLR/Vpp/THV RC5/SDO
25 LED-RED
RC6/TX/CK
26 D3 10k 10k 10k 10k 10k
RC7/RX/DT
19
RD0/PSP0 a a b c d e
20 LED-RED
RD1/PSP1
21
b D4
RD2/PSP2 c
22
RD3/PSP3 d
27
RD4/PSP4 e
28 LED-RED
RD5/PSP5
29 D5
RD6/PSP6
30
RD7/PSP7
PIC16F877A LED-RED
Nivel mximo: LCD1
LM016L

RV1

50%

VDD
VSS

VEE

RW
RS

D0
D1
D2
D3
D4
D5
D6
D7
E
1
2
3

4
5
6

7
8
9
10
11
12
13
14
1k
Reinicio

U1
13 33
OSC1/CLKIN RB0/INT
14 34
OSC2/CLKOUT RB1
35
RB2
2 36
RA0/AN0 RB3/PGM
3
4
RA1/AN1
RA2/AN2/VREF-/CVREF
RB4
RB5
37
38 Simulacion de niveles
5 39
RA3/AN3/VREF+ RB6/PGC
6 40
7
RA4/T0CKI/C1OUT RB7/PGD D1
RA5/AN4/SS/C2OUT R2
R1 RC0/T1OSO/T1CKI
15 R3 NIVEL 10 NIVEL 8 NIVEL 6 NIVEL 4 NIVEL2
10k 8 16 R4
330
RE0/AN5/RD RC1/T1OSI/CCP2
9 17 R5 LED-RED
10
RE1/AN6/WR RC2/CCP1
18
330 D2
RE2/AN7/CS RC3/SCK/SCL
23
R6
330
RC4/SDI/SDA 330
1 24 330
MCLR/Vpp/THV RC5/SDO
25 LED-RED
RC6/TX/CK
26 D3 10k 10k 10k 10k 10k
RC7/RX/DT
19
RD0/PSP0 a a b c d e
20 LED-RED
RD1/PSP1
21
b D4
RD2/PSP2 c
22
RD3/PSP3 d
27
RD4/PSP4 e
28 LED-RED
RD5/PSP5
29 D5
RD6/PSP6
30
RD7/PSP7
PIC16F877A LED-RED

You might also like